# Squatwatch scanner env — read me first, plugin folks
#
# Squatwatch checks the Lintbarrel registry for typo-squatted package names,
# and your plugins run inside the same worker process, so don't reorder these
# vars unless you enjoy confusing stack traces. SW_PLUGIN_DIR must point at
# your plugin folder, SW_SCAN_INTERVAL is in minutes, and SW_STRICT=1 makes
# near-miss names fail the build. One more thing before your plugin can call
# the registry: the API credential it needs goes on the line right below.

sealed setting: ARCHIVE_KEY3=8d0

Action item (P1): The Fairgate rate-parity checker stored scraped competitor rates with partner credentials in plaintext logs for 11 days. Rotate all affected tokens, purge log archives, and add a redaction filter to the scraper output stage. Owner: Marek. Due in two weeks. Full remediation checklist is tracked on the internal page below.

wiki page, tahaf-tajog: https://jira.ordindyn.corp/pipeline

- [ ] Step 7: Archive cold storage buckets (Glacierline tier). Confirm both ceremony witnesses are present, verify bucket manifests match the Oxbow ledger, then seal the archive key shares. Plugin authors may observe but not handle shares. Once sealed, the archive index itself is encrypted and can only be reopened with the passphrase below.

vault phrase of badup-hahig = tamael-aldael-kelmir-istael-fenok-istwyn-tamius-jorath-oliion

[ ] Verify Panediff's large-file diff viewer against the regression corpus before tagging the release. This includes the 400 MB log fixture, the binary-with-text-header case, and the mixed line-ending file that broke chunked rendering last quarter. Confirm that the viewer falls back to paginated mode above the size threshold rather than attempting a full in-memory diff, and that the fallback banner renders. Record memory peak from the soak run in the release notes. Sign-off requires quoting the build token that appears on the next line.

pipeline stamp: htk31_f769b577b3028a4e9958e5bb8d1259a